Ecuador – Four Worlds in One Country

Ecuador is a small country with huge diversity — from Andean peaks to Amazon rainforests, Pacific beaches to the Galápagos Islands. It’s a dream destination for adventurers, nature lovers, and culture enthusiasts alike.


Altitude

  • From sea level at the coast to 6,263 meters (20,548 ft) at Chimborazo, the highest point in Ecuador (and the closest point on Earth to the sun due to the equatorial bulge).

Distance from Airport / Railway Station

  • Main International Airports:
    • Mariscal Sucre International Airport (UIO), Quito – ~40 km (45–60 min) from Quito city center.
    • José Joaquín de Olmedo International Airport (GYE), Guayaquil – ~5 km (10 min) from downtown.
  • Limited railway services for tourism (e.g., Tren Crucero routes).

Best Time to Visit

  • Highlands (Quito, Andes): June to September – dry season, perfect for trekking.
  • Amazon: Year-round rain, but August and December are slightly drier.
  • Coast & Galápagos: December to May – warmer, calmer seas for wildlife viewing and diving.

Top Attractions

  • Quito’s Historic Center – UNESCO World Heritage Site with colonial architecture.
  • Galápagos Islands – Unique wildlife and pristine landscapes.
  • Cotopaxi National Park – Majestic snow-capped volcano.
  • Baños – Waterfalls, hot springs, and adventure sports.
  • Cuenca – Historic city with charming plazas.
  • Amazon Rainforest (Tena, Yasuni National Park) – Incredible biodiversity.

Adventure Activities

  • Hiking & Climbing – Chimborazo, Cotopaxi, and Quilotoa Loop.
  • Diving & Snorkeling – Galápagos and coastal waters.
  • Rafting & Kayaking – Rivers near Tena and Baños.
  • Mountain Biking – Cotopaxi downhill routes.
  • Wildlife Tours – Birdwatching, jungle trekking, and whale watching (June–September).

How to Reach

  • By Air: Direct international flights to Quito and Guayaquil from the Americas and Europe.
  • By Land: Bus connections from Colombia and Peru.
  • By Sea: Cruises to the Galápagos depart from the mainland (Guayaquil, Manta).

Ideal Trip Duration

  • 10–14 days to experience both mainland Ecuador and the Galápagos Islands.
